Srinagar, Aug. 10 -- The anti-terror operation in Kulgam district of Jammu and Kashmir, aimed at flushing out a group of highly trained terrorists holed up in a dense forest, entered its tenth day today.

The encounter began on August 1 after a joint team of forces launched an operation based on inputs about the presence of a large terror group in the Akhal forest area.

So far, two soldiers from the Army's elite counter-insurgency unit,Lance Naik Pritpal Singh of Manupur village in Khanna and Sepoy Harminder Singh of Badinpur village in Mandi Gobindgarh, Punjab,have been killed, while eight others have sustained injuries. Two terrorists, including a local militant, were neutralised in the initial phase of the gunfight.
